Retour sur la première édition de la conférence Best Of Web

Vendredi 5 juin a eu lieu, à Paris, la conférence Best Of Web. Cette conférence permet, en une journée, de revoir les meilleures présentations de l’année données dans les différents meetups de la capitale : AngularJS, Backbone.js, Web Components, EmberJs, Node.js, Phonegap/Cordova, D3.js et Paris.js.
Bien évidemment, Zenika était partenaire de cette initiative, et deux consultants, Matthieu LUX et Emmanuel DEMEY, vont vous partager cette journée intense, techniquement parlant.

Au programme, 13 conférences autour de différents sujets web : des frameworks JavaScript (AngularJS, Backbone, Ember, Polymer) à librairie D3.js, en passant par la programmation réactive, les bonnes pratiques lors du développement d’API REST et l’outillage autour des applications Cordova.
L’un des coup de coeur d’Emmanuel sera la présentation de la Web Audio API. Cette spécification HTML permet, depuis le navigateur, de rajouter différents effets à des sources audio. Norbert Schnell et Samuel Goldszmidt, travaillant à l’IRCAM, nous ont présenté le travail qu’ils réalisent autour de cette API méconnue.

Un autre article sera consacré sur cette spécification HTML5, afin de vous présenter ses nombreuses possibilités.
Pour Matthieu, un coup de coeur et un coup de gueule. Étonnamment, le coup de coeur vient du CSS avec la présentation du Grid layout par Mathieu Parisot. Après tant d’années à bidouiller (car c’est le mot) avec les positionnements flottant, nous découvrons tout juste Flexbox avec bonheur. Mais le W3C n’a visiblement pas décidé de s’arrêter là et travaille déjà un type de positionnement supplémentaire, le mode “grid” qui permettra de proposer une disposition sous forme de grille, facile à utiliser, puissante, et sans détourner ce bon vieux élément ‘table’.
Le coup de gueule sera au niveau du manque d’ouverture et des “guerres de religions”. Un bon troll anime le débat, suscite les réactions, ce n’est pas le problème. Mais lorsque chacun présente son framework en dénigrant les autres, cela devient lassant. Dans une conférence dont le thème était la réunion de tous les meetups du Web, le manque de cohésion était flagrant.
En plus de ces 13 conférences, de nombreuses présentations ont été réalisées pendant les différentes pauses de la journée. Notamment, l’équipe de Firefox a réalisé des petites démonstrations de Firefox OS et de la nouvelle version de Firefox Developer Edition. Pour cette dernière version, notons notamment de nouvelles fonctionnalités dans les outils de développement, par exemple, l’intégration d’outils pour débugger des canvas ou pour visualiser les différentes briques de la Web Audio API.
Cette première session fût un bon moyen d’aborder certaines technologies que nous n’utilisons pas quotidiennement (Web Audio API, le développement sur Kinect, …). Nous souhaitons remercier les différents organisateurs. Et nous leur donnons rendez-vous l’année prochaine pour la seconde édition.
Nos deux consultants ont recensé les différents supports utilisés lors de ces conférences. Ci-dessous, vous trouverez les liens vers le profile Twitter/Google+ des speakers, ainsi qu’un lien vers les slides des présentations :
Keynote

REST World

Pourquoi choisir Backbone en 2015 ?

Kinect pour les développeurs Web

Automate your cordova workflow with tarifa CLI

Visualisations en temps réel avec d3.js

Native Javascript applications with NodeWebkit Conférence de : Jacopo Daeli
CSS Grid, le futur de vos mises en page

ES2015 ready Angular web stack

Web Audio Now !

Material design avec Polymer Conférence de : Martin Görner Les slides
Reactive Programming avec RxJS

Building an application with Ember.js in 2015

Auteur/Autrice

Laisser un commentaire

Ce site utilise Akismet pour réduire les indésirables. En savoir plus sur comment les données de vos commentaires sont utilisées.

%d blogueurs aiment cette page :